Geospatial Data Schema (CSV/XLSX/JSON) & WGS84 Reference Standards

All coordinate data in our repository follows the WGS84 (World Geodetic System 1984) standard. This ensures compatibility with modern GIS software, Google Maps API, and Leaflet.js.

Important: Latitude/longitude values represent approximate centroids of administrative localities (not surveyed points and not property boundaries). The number of decimals reflects formatting, not guaranteed real-world accuracy.

Parameter Standard Precision
Coordinates Decimal Degrees Up to 6 decimal places
Character Set UTF-8 (Unicode) Full international support
ISO Standard ISO 3166-1 alpha-2 Valid 2-letter codes

Administrative Hierarchy Mapping

To maintain consistency across diverse national structures, we map local divisions to a standardized 4-level hierarchy:

Admin Level 1: State, Province, Region, or Autonomous Community.
Admin Level 2: County, Prefecture, or Department.
Admin Level 3: Municipality or District.
Place Name: The primary locality or town associated with the code.

Versioning & Dataset Maintenance

Datasets are periodically rebuilt and sanity-checked for consistency (schema, hierarchy mapping, and basic geo constraints). Update frequency may vary by country.

For production onboarding, validate delimiter handling, character encoding, null semantics, and numeric coercion before first import. We recommend checksum verification, deterministic column mapping, and idempotent loaders so recurring refreshes can be applied safely with rollback support in case of malformed upstream payloads.
